Latest web development tutorials

Python Datei nächste (Methode)

Python-Datei (File) Methode Python - Datei (File) Methode


Umriss

Methodenext () , wenn die Datei ein Iterator wird verwendet werden, in einer Schleife, next () -Methode wird in jedem Zyklus aufgerufen werden, gibt die Methode die nächste Zeile der Datei, wenn Sie das Ende (EOF), den Abzug StopIteration

Grammatik

next () Methode hat die folgende Syntax:

fileObject.next(); 

Parameter

  • keine

Rückgabewert

Liefert die Datei, um die nächste Zeile.

Beispiele

Das folgende Beispiel zeigt die nächste () Art der Nutzung:

W3big.txt Inhaltsdatei wie folgt:

这是第一行
这是第二行
这是第三行
这是第四行
这是第五行

Schleife liest den Inhalt der Datei:

#!/usr/bin/python
# -*- coding: UTF-8 -*-

# 打开文件
fo = open("w3big.txt", "rw+")
print "文件名为: ", fo.name

for index in range(5):
    line = fo.next()
    print "第 %d 行 - %s" % (index, line)

# 关闭文件
fo.close()

Das obige Beispiel Ausgabe lautet:

文件名为:  w3big.txt
第 0 行 - 这是第一行

第 1 行 - 这是第二行

第 2 行 - 这是第三行

第 3 行 - 这是第四行

第 4 行 - 这是第五行

Python-Datei (File) Methode Python - Datei (File) Methode